On Sun, 21 Sept 2025 at 15:29, Michael Bien <mbie...@gmail.com> wrote:
Once the first project opens, NB will open the Projects and Files tabs (logical 
and physical
project view as they are called in the implementation, now with tooltips #8786).

I think we should also open the Favorites tab in the same tab group, since it 
serves as
view for non-project based use cases (also #8798 for adding the project dir by 
default).

It might get tight in that tab group since the Services tab is there too, so 
this might
mean that we move it over where the Navigator is, or possibly not open Services
by default?
Massive +1 to replacing Services by Favorites in the default tabs.  As
you probably know, as I've said this to you in at least two other
places recently! :-)

Favorites is becoming more important with the support for project-less
Java files, and we should make it easier for beginners to find.
Getting it to open with first file would be even better.  I can't
remember the last time I used the Services tab for anything, and I
don't think it's that useful for initial usage.  Anyone who needs it
probably knows where to find it.

I think the naming is awkward, but we may be stuck with that now?
Ideally Favorites would be called Files or File Browser, and Files
would be called something else.  Something like Projects, Project
Files and File Browser could be something to consider.  It can be
branded in the nb cluster if need be.  Let's not forget that people
find the current naming and purpose of the various tabs confusing -
eg. https://github.com/apache/netbeans/discussions/6387 and various
other posts over the years.
